§ 199-o. Independent range estimate required. (a) Any entity that\nsells a zero-emission school bus to a school district or contractor for\nuse in providing transportation services to a school district located\nwithin the state of New York shall be required to provide an independent\nthird-party range estimate to prospective purchasers prior to such a\nsale. Such range estimate must, at a minimum, provide the estimated\nrange on different terrain and different weather conditions. The range\nestimate shall also include the average level of battery degradation per\nten thousand miles traveled. The range estimate shall also consider\nwhether the bus is stored outside or utilizes an indoor garage. For the\npurposes of this section "zero-emission school bus" shall have the same\nmeaning as in subdivision one of section thirty-six hundred thirty-eight\nof the education law.\n (b) Nothing in this section shall be interpreted to impact sales\ncompleted prior to January first, two thousand twenty-six, provided\nhowever that if the entity selling such zero-emission school buses later\nreceives a range estimate for the model or models sold prior to January\nfirst, two thousand twenty-six, the selling entity shall provide such\nrange estimate to the purchasing school district or contractor.\n
